I love homemade ice cream, but I hate how much work it is to make it!!  I can honestly say this is the easiest ice cream ever. If you want vanilla, it’s just two ingredients! Chocolate adds one more. Quick, easy, and sooooo yummy!

I used my KitchenAid Ice Cream Maker Attachment because I have one, and I love it. No rock salt or anything needed with it. It’s pretty easy to use.  I also like to do things with reckless abandon, so I didn’t look up how to actually use it. I did read the manual the first time, but that was at least a year ago and I can’t remember what I did this morning. So, yeah, you should check your own ice cream maker’s manual for best results.

As for the value, the pudding package has a tag on it that says 49¢ and the sweetened condensed milk was 69¢ (off brand, probably from a “crash and dent” grocery store).  If you add in the milk, I still spent well under $1.50 for the whole pint of ice cream.  This stuff is better than Talenti which costs about $6 per pint!

Homemade Chocolate Ice Cream Pudding ~ Only 3 Ingredients!


  • Author: gimmie
Print Recipe
Pin Recipe

Description

Homemade ice cream is a favorite at my house! Whether you want the full ice-cream maker experience or you just want a quick treat (or don’t have a machine), you can score with this sweet treat your whole family will love.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 – 14-ounce can sweetened condensed milk
  • 2 cups heavy cream (1 pint)
  • 1 package chocolate pudding

Instructions

  1. Pre-freeze your ice cream maker’s bowl (overnight, or 24 hours if you have time). Check your’s instructions for best results. Assemble your ice cream maker.
  2. Add ingredients to a bowl and mix well, or if possible mix in a blender until smooth.
  3. Pour the ice cream mixture into the ice-cream maker’s frozen bowl and turn it on. Follow directions for your machine for how long to churn.
  4. I recommend serving immediately for the best soft-serve consistency. But, you can also freeze in a freezer-safe container for a few hours. Then, let it thaw a few minutes before scooping it out to serve.

No Churn Method:

  1. Follow steps above, but instead of churning in an ice cream machine, put in a freezer-safe container instead. Freeze for 5+ hours. Remove from freezer and allow to stand for 2-3 minutes. Then, scoop up and serve.
